Dan Graziano of the Star-Ledger is reporting that the Mets and Red Sox are currently negotiating a trade that will send catcher Brian Schneider to Boston.

He writes,

A person familiar with the discussions, who declined to be identified because he’s not authorized to speak publicly about them, confirmed that the Red Sox and the Mets were discussing a deal that would send catcher Brian Schneider to Boston.

According to this person, the Mets would only do the deal if they were sure they could get a catcher in another deal or free agency. The free-agent catching pool is weak, though the Mets have, during this off-season, expressed at least some tepid interest in guys like Jason Varitek and Pudge Rodriguez.

Graziano also mentions that the Mets could pursue another catcher via a second trade, particularly for Baltimore’s Ramon Hernandez who was once high on the Mets’ wish list.

Jon Heyman had mentioned not to long ago, that the Mets might be looking to upgrade at catcher and specifically mentioned the Giants’ Benji Molina as a possibility.
